As opposed to waiting for SMON to roll again dead transactions, new transactions can recover blocking transactions on their own to obtain the row locks they need to have. This feature is known as quick transaction rollback.
If ARCH encounters an mistake when trying to archive a gaggle (as an example, due to an invalid or crammed location), ARCH carries on attempting to archive the team. An error can be written while in the ARCH trace file and the Inform file. If the condition just isn't fixed, finally all on the internet redo log teams become complete, nevertheless not archived, as well as program halts mainly because no group is available to LGWR.
Partial backups are only valuable for any database running in ARCHIVELOG method. Since an archived redo log is existing, the datafiles restored from a partial backup might be designed in line with the rest of the database all through recovery methods.

The Bodily hardware on which the standby database resides should be utilized only as being a disaster recovery system; no other applications need to operate on it. Since the standby database is suitable for disaster recovery, it ideally resides in a very separate Bodily site from the primary database.
Oracle supplies a reputable and supported mechanism for employing a standby database process to facilitate rapid disaster recovery. The plan works by using a secondary system on duplicate hardware, maintained in a constant state of media recovery through the application of log files archived at the primary site.
